I do not see how this is connected to bug #374101 .
The problem is the wrong parameters in the xorg.conf for this touchpad. As far
as I can see this information comes from /usr/share/sax/api/data/cdb/Pointers.
ALPS:Touchpad {
Driver = synaptics
Device = /dev/input/mice
RawOption = "SHMConfig" "on","Protocol" "auto-dev","LeftEdge"
"120","RightEdge" "830","TopEdge" "120","BottomEdge" "650","FingerLow"
"14","FingerHigh" "15","MaxTapTime" "180","MaxTapMove"
"110","EmulateMidButtonTime" "75","VertScrollDelta" "20","HorizScrollDelta"
"20","MinSpeed" "0.2","MaxSpeed" "0.5","AccelFactor"
"0.01","EdgeMotionMinSpeed" "15","EdgeMotionMaxSpeed" "15","UpDownScrolling"
"1","CircularScrolling" "1","CircScrollDelta" "0.1","CircScrollTrigger" "2"
ZAxisMapping = 4 5
Emulate3Buttons = on
}
Is this supposed to be adapted somewhere?
These options are about right: | But the default is:
================================================================
Option "LeftEdge" "100" | "LeftEdge" "120"
Option "RightEdge" "1100" | "RightEdge" "830"
Option "TopEdge" "50" | "TopEdge" "120"
Option "BottomEdge" "300" | "BottomEdge" "650"
